About the Team Collaboration Skills Course

Team Collaboration Skills is a practical Business course designed to help you work more effectively with others, whether you are part of a small team or a larger organization. You will learn how to improve communication, strengthen trust, and support shared goals so your team can achieve better results with less friction.

Learn how to collaborate with confidence, clarity, and consistency in any team environment.

This course begins with the foundations of effective collaboration, helping you understand what productive teamwork looks like in real Business settings. You will explore team roles, shared responsibility, and how clear expectations create smoother workflows and fewer misunderstandings. These early lessons give you a strong base for contributing more effectively from day one.

As the course progresses, you will build essential communication habits for team success. You will practice speaking clearly, listening well, and asking better questions so you can support stronger coordination and fewer errors. You will also learn how to build trust and psychological safety, create team norms, and run meetings and check-ins that keep people aligned and focused.

The course also covers the interpersonal side of Team Collaboration Skills, including working with different styles, giving and receiving constructive feedback, handling conflict respectfully, and making group decisions more effectively. You will learn how to share information across the team, avoid silos, and support accountability so work moves forward with less confusion and more ownership.

Finally, you will see how modern teams collaborate in hybrid and remote environments, where clarity and consistency matter even more. By the end of the course, you will have a personal collaboration action plan and the confidence to build practical habits for clearer communication, stronger trust, and better team results. You will leave ready to contribute more positively, work more smoothly with others, and make a measurable difference in your Business team.
